**Runbook: Account Recovery — TumbleVault Locker Flow**

When a Fernbrook Laundry customer loses access to their TumbleVault locker account, support verifies identity via the registered pickup history, then issues a one-time unlock through the admin console. Note for review: the unlock endpoint is rate-limited and fully audited; overrides require two-person approval. If the admin console itself is locked, the operator authenticates with the passphrase below.

unlock words, tagaf-hahif: ralwyn-lammir-rusax-sormir

## Authentication

Sqlherd enforces our SQL linting rules in CI and on pre-commit. Rules live in the Quarrow registry, and the linter fetches the active ruleset on every run rather than bundling it. That fetch goes through the internal Quarrow API, which requires authentication even for read-only access — this was a deliberate choice after the Larkmont cache-poisoning writeup. Local runs and CI share the same credential for now. The linter expects the key directly below.

API key for yahig-tadup: kto7_ubizbYm

Hey future maintainer — digest scheduling in Plumfield is weirder than it looks. The batch emailer (Tinroof) runs hourly, but digests only fire when a user's local time crosses their preferred send hour, so the cron is really a sweep, not a trigger. Don't "fix" that. If Tinroof's scheduler state gets corrupted, you rebuild it from the Quartzbin snapshot, which sits in an encrypted bucket. Unsealing that bucket requires the recovery passphrase, and to save you a scavenger hunt, it's written directly below this paragraph.

strongbox words: zordor-quenax